Screen Printing: A Traditional Approach

Screen printing is a time-honored method that involves transferring ink through a mesh screen onto the t-shirt fabric. This technique is ideal for designs with bold colors and intricate details, making it a popular choice for large-scale production runs.

Advantages of Screen Printing

Screen printing offers several advantages, including high color vibrancy, durability, and cost-effectiveness for bulk orders. Additionally, it provides excellent color opacity, allowing for vibrant designs on dark-colored garments.

Considerations When Choosing Screen Printing

While screen printing is suitable for many applications, it may not be the best choice for designs with gradients or complex color schemes. Additionally, setup costs can be higher compared to other methods, making it less economical for small orders.

Direct-to-Garment (DTG) Printing: Precision and Detail

Direct-to-Garment (DTG) printing is a digital printing technique that involves printing designs directly onto the fabric using specialized inkjet technology. This method is well-suited for intricate designs and small batch orders.

Advantages of DTG Printing

DTG printing offers unparalleled precision and detail, making it ideal for designs with gradients, fine lines, and intricate artwork. It also allows for on-demand printing, eliminating the need for minimum order quantities and reducing setup costs.

Considerations When Choosing DTG Printing

While DTG printing excels in detail and versatility, it may not be as cost-effective as screen printing for large production runs. Additionally, the final results can vary depending on the type of fabric used, with some fabrics yielding better results than others.

Heat Transfer Printing: Versatility and Convenience

Heat transfer printing involves transferring designs onto t-shirts using heat and pressure to adhere a vinyl or digital transfer onto the fabric. This method offers versatility and convenience, making it suitable for small-scale projects and personalized orders.

Advantages of Heat Transfer Printing

Heat transfer printing allows for full-color designs with intricate details, making it ideal for custom and one-off designs. It also offers the flexibility to print on a wide range of fabrics, including cotton, polyester, and blends.

Considerations When Choosing Heat Transfer Printing

While heat transfer printing is convenient and versatile, it may not be as durable as other methods, with designs prone to cracking or fading over time. Additionally, the process requires specialized equipment and materials, which can add to production costs.

Sublimation Printing: Vibrant and Long-Lasting

Sublimation printing involves transferring dye onto t-shirts using heat and pressure to create vibrant, long-lasting designs. This method is particularly well-suited for polyester garments, producing results that are both durable and fade-resistant.

Advantages of Sublimation Printing

Sublimation printing offers exceptional color vibrancy and durability, with designs that are resistant to fading, cracking, and peeling. It also allows for full-color, all-over printing, making it ideal for custom and photographic designs.

Considerations When Choosing Sublimation Printing

While sublimation printing produces stunning results on polyester fabrics, it is not suitable for cotton or other natural fibers. Additionally, the process requires specialized equipment and heat-resistant materials, which may not be cost-effective for small orders.
